[Bug 560524] New: Network CD installation on ASUS 1000HE fails with script error
http://bugzilla.novell.com/show_bug.cgi?id=560524 http://bugzilla.novell.com/show_bug.cgi?id=560524#c0 Summary: Network CD installation on ASUS 1000HE fails with script error Classification: openSUSE Product: openSUSE 11.2 Version: Final Platform: Other OS/Version: Other Status: NEW Severity: Critical Priority: P5 - None Component: Installation AssignedTo: bnc-team-screening@forge.provo.novell.com ReportedBy: rfno@fietze-home.de QAContact: jsrain@novell.com Found By: --- Blocker: --- User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(compatible; Konqueror/4.3; Linux) KHTML/4.3.3 (like Gecko) SUSE When booting an ASUS EeePC 1000HE either from an USB stick or an USB CDROM drive using the network installation CD OS 11.2, the installation aborts after loading the installation system. When I then run the ASCII installation, I can stop the screen after the loading of the installation system with Ctrl-S and see the following errors en masse (pleae forgive any types, I had to copy them by hand): .. /usr/lib/YaST2/startup/common/misc.sh: line 53: cut: command not found /usr/lib/YaST2/startup/common/misc.sh: line 53: tr: command not found /usr/lib/YaST2/startup/common/misc.sh: line 53: cut: command not found /usr/lib/YaST2/startup/common/misc.sh: line 53: export: '=' not a valid identifier /usr/lib/YaST2/startup/common/misc.sh: line 53: cut: command not found /usr/lib/YaST2/startup/common/misc.sh: line 53: tr: command not found /usr/lib/YaST2/startup/common/misc.sh: line 53: cut: command not found .. and so on The computer has 1GiB RAM, is running OS11.1, Windows XP w/o problems including the USB CDROM drive. I checked the Net Installation ISO, it's ok (md5). Tried download.opensuse.org and ftp5.gwdg.de, no difference. The machine booted OS11.1 w/o any problem from an USB stick or the drive. Could you please attach y2logs according to http://en.opensuse.org/Bugs/YaST.
Wow, didn't even know that's possible. What I did: - connected eth - boot from CD (USB-CDROM) - selected German language - boot param: startshell=1 - start installation pressing ENTER Get error "cannot find opensuse installation repository", and into the ASCII installation menu. Here I start a shell, find my USB stick and: - mount /dev/sdb /var/log # mount wouldn't allow me -o switches? - mkdir /var/log/YaST2 - cd / - Ctrl-D - Start installation, eth0, DHCP, no proxy, no auth Now, after loading the installation system the system shows me multiple screens of the error messages as described in the bug description. I go back to the shell and umoujt the stick. The only file I found there afterwards was y2start.log in the YaST2 subdir.
